DTF Transfers Explained: A Beginner’s Guide to the DTF Printing Process and Application
DTF transfers explained: Direct-to-film transfers are a versatile option for creating custom T-shirts with vibrant color and a soft hand. The process relies on printing a design onto a special release film, applying adhesive, and then transferring the image to fabric with a heat press. This approach works across a wide range of fabrics and is particularly friendly for beginners who want reliable results without the heavy setup of traditional screen printing.
DTF printing process unfolds through several distinct steps that influence the final look and durability of Custom T-shirt design DTF projects. Start with design and color separation, ensuring your artwork is print-ready. Next, print the design onto a specialty DTF film using pigment-based inks, then dust the wet ink with adhesive powder. After curing the powder, transfer the film to the garment with controlled heat and pressure, and finish by peeling the carrier film either hot or cold, followed by a final press if required.
Essential materials and equipment—DTF printer and inks, DTF film, adhesive powder, a curing device, a heat press, and basic accessories—help keep the workflow predictable. DTF Transfers in Practice: How to Apply DTF Transfers, Care Tips, and Choosing Between DTF and Screen Printing
DTF transfers in practice often hinge on choosing the right method for the project. Compared with screen printing, DTF transfers offer advantages for small runs and personalized designs, with less setup and faster turnarounds. When evaluating DTF transfer vs screen print, consider factors such as color complexity, fabric variety, and scalability. DTF also compares favorably to traditional heat transfer vinyl for complex, full-color images while maintaining a softer hand.
How to apply DTF transfers: a practical, step-by-step guide you can follow for professional results. 1) Prepare the garment by lightly pre-warming to remove moisture. 2) Position the transfer face-down on the fabric and secure it with heat-resistant tape if needed. 3) Apply heat and pressure at the recommended settings (roughly 300–330°F / 150–165°C) with medium to firm pressure for 10–20 seconds, depending on film specifications. 4) Peel the carrier film hot or cold as instructed, then re-press if a finishing pass is recommended. 5) Allow the garment to cool and follow any post-press care guidelines to maximize adhesion and color retention.
Care and troubleshooting are essential for longevity. Fading colors, peeling edges, or stiffness can often be traced back to incomplete curing or excessive ink load. Use high-quality films, optimize heat and pressure for the fabric type, and adhere to proper washing instructions—turn garments inside-out, wash cold, avoid harsh detergents, and line-dry when possible. Frequently Asked Questions
DTF transfers explained: What is the DTF printing process and how does the DTF transfer vs screen print compare?
DTF transfers are digital prints on a release film coated with adhesive powder. In the DTF printing process, you design and color-separate artwork, print onto a DTF film with pigment inks, apply adhesive powder, cure the powder, transfer the image to fabric with a heat press, and finally peel the carrier film. Compared with screen printing, DTF is typically more economical for small runs and complex full-color designs, works on a wider range of fabrics (including dark textiles with a white underbase), and offers a softer hand with simpler setup. For durability, ensure proper curing and follow heat/pressure guidelines, and care for the garment to maximize color longevity.
Custom T-shirt design DTF: What are the essential steps to apply DTF transfers and how should you care for them to maximize longevity?
To apply DTF transfers: pre-warm the garment to remove moisture, place the transfer face-down on the fabric, set your heat press to the recommended temperature (approximately 300-330°F / 150-165°C) with medium to firm pressure, press for 10-20 seconds, then peel the carrier film hot or cold according to the product instructions, and optionally re-press for full adhesion. Aftercare: turn the shirt inside-out before washing, use cold or warm water, avoid bleach or harsh detergents, and line-dry or use low heat. For best results in a Custom T-shirt design DTF, use high-resolution artwork, plan color separations (white underbase on dark fabrics if needed), and ensure proper curing and fabric compatibility to maintain color vibrancy and durability.
